After Embassy Move, U.S. to Sell Envoy’s House Near Tel Aviv for $87M

Summary by tjvnews.com
By: Ilan Ben Zion The State Department has put the ambassador to Israel’s official residence outside Tel Aviv up for sale, in a decision aimed at cementing the American embassy’s controversial move to Jerusalem. The beachfront mansion in the affluent Tel Aviv suburb of Herzliya is going on the market because most of Ambassador David Friedman’s day-to-day activities are based at the embassy in Jerusalem, the State Department said. “Following the …
